MEMO — Veltrane Systems, Receiving, Dorsey Point site

Six Quillax M4 demo units are being returned from the Harwick trade floor. All were powered down and factory-reset by the field team; do not re-image before intake inspection. Log serial plates against the loan sheet and flag any missing styli. Cartons are marked DEMO RETURN in orange. Expected arrival Thursday morning via courier. Storage bay 3 is reserved. The confidential hand-over instruction for the courier follows below.

courier memo of kagug-yajof: the belys wenok courier leaves the praix ledger at gate 8902 under passcode 669584

**Occupancy Feed Ingestion — GarageSense**

The GarageSense feed publishes stall-level occupancy deltas from the Brentholm garages every few seconds. Because sensors occasionally emit duplicate or out-of-order events, the ingester applies a dedupe window and a reorder buffer before committing counts. If you are paged for occupancy drift, first confirm the buffer has not saturated; saturation silently drops late events and skews totals. All thresholds are configurable at runtime and checked on deploy. The current defaults follow.

tuning constants:
QUOTAS = {
    "quenael": 10,
    "oliwyn": 1,
}

Quarterly Planning Note — Revised Commission Scheme

Finance team: from next quarter, the Bravance commission scheme moves to tiered accelerators with a capped multiplier on renewals. Please model payout exposure under the Hollis scenarios and flag any variance above plan before month-end close. Reconciliation rules are documented in the Tarnwick folder. The strategic rationale is summarized confidentially below.

internal memo for yahag-hahig: Belwynix Group plans to lower the Silir list price by 62 percent in May.

Handover — Commission Scheme (Ravel to Instone)

Revised scheme live from Q3. Key points: base rate drops to 4%, accelerators kick in at 110% of quota, multi-year deals weighted 1.3x. Heads of department own communication to their teams; no side arrangements. Disputes route through Comp Committee, monthly. Legacy deals booked before cutover pay out under old terms. Watch the Pellard team — morale is shaky. The strategic reasoning behind the rate change is noted below.

board note of bawip-kawef: Headcount on the Quenwyn team goes from 3 to 80 by the end of April. Gross margin on Quenwyn came in at 5 percent against a plan of 15 percent.